Output 0870394a7b43bf080d51e7804dfd8f6945fb392ba192795dcc202caa009cfc45:16

value
21272579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c8d166c3757c8984e9363305f49743c0e7e1799 OP_EQUAL
address
MHo8E5uXZ85dum5HPGqVckQmsPm6yeGwBd
transaction
0870394a7b43bf080d51e7804dfd8f6945fb392ba192795dcc202caa009cfc45
spent
true